当前位置:首页 > 虚拟化 > 正文

虚拟化是怎么形成的(简述什么是虚拟化)

虚拟化技术的形成主要有以下几个步骤:

1. 硬件抽象层(HAL)的出现:HAL是一种软件组件,它能够在不同的硬件平台上提供一个统一的编程接口。HAL的出现使得软件开发人员可以开发出在不同硬件平台上都能运行的应用程序。

2. 虚拟机管理程序(Hypervisor)的开发:Hypervisor是一种运行在HAL之上的软件,它能够创建和管理虚拟机。虚拟机是一种隔离的运行环境,它可以运行自己的操作系统和应用程序。Hypervisor通过隔离虚拟机之间的资源,确保每个虚拟机都能安全可靠地运行。

3. 虚拟化软件的出现:随着Hypervisor的成熟,虚拟化软件开始出现。虚拟化软件是一种能够安装在物理服务器上的软件,它可以将物理服务器划分为多个虚拟机。虚拟化软件的出现使得企业能够在单台物理服务器上运行多个应用程序,从而提高服务器的利用率和降低成本。

4. 云计算平台的诞生:云计算平台是一种基于虚拟化的分布式计算平台。它将硬件资源抽象成虚拟资源池,并提供统一的管理和调度机制。云计算平台使得企业能够在多个物理服务器上运行应用程序,从而实现弹性扩展和负载均衡。

虚拟化技术的形成是一个循序渐进的过程,它经历了HAL的出现、Hypervisor的开发、虚拟化软件的出现和云计算平台的诞生等几个阶段。虚拟化技术的发展为企业带来了巨大的好处,它提高了服务器的利用率、降低了成本、实现了弹性扩展和负载均衡,并为云计算的发展奠定了基础。